Web15 de mai. de 2024 · An irrevocable letter of credit is a guarantee from a bank, issued in the form of a letter. It creates an agreement where the buyer's bank agrees to pay the seller as soon as certain conditions of the transaction are met. These letters help eliminate concerns that unknown buyers won't pay for goods they receive or that unknown sellers … A letter of credit (LC), also known as a documentary credit or bankers commercial credit, or letter of undertaking (LoU), is a payment mechanism used in international trade to provide an economic guarantee from a creditworthy bank to an exporter of goods. Letters of credit are used extensively in the financing of international trade, when the reliability of contracting parties cannot be readil…
